The Meaning of Dillamore: Exploring the Surname's History and Etymology

The esteemed name of Dillamore is one of the anglicized variations of the Old Norman French surname "de La Mare," which was introduced to England after the conquest of 1066. It originally derived from a place name of one of the locations in Normandy called "La Mare." The Old Norman French "la" meaning "the," and "mare" meaning "pool" or "pond." The fusion of the preposition "de," meaning "of," has origins in the Early Middle Ages.

Many later forms of the name stem from the medieval English understanding of the surname as derived from the Anglo-Norman French "de la," combined with Middle English "mere" meaning "pool," or "more" meaning "moor," creating topographic surnames for those living near a lake, pond, swamp, or moor.

Early examples of the name include Coleman de Lamora (1135, Northamptonshire); Robert de la Mare (1190, Suffolk); William de la Mere (1260, Essex); and Henry Dalamare (1385, Yorkshire). The anglicized variations of the surname range from Delamar(e), Delamere, Delamore, and Dallimore to Dillamore, Dol(l)amore, Dolle(y)more, and Dollimore.

Some bearers of the modern surname may descend from a French Huguenot family that fled to Britain in the 17th and early 18th centuries to escape religious persecution. Pierre, son of Antoine De la Marre, was baptized on December 23, 1632, at the Threadneedle Street French Huguenot Church in London. Many of these names settled in the Eastern Counties; William Dillamore married Sarah Costin on October 31, 1695, in St. Mary's, Tuddenham, Suffolk, Oxfordshire during the reign of King Henry I, also known as "The Lion of Justice," 1100-1135.

Surnames became necessary as governments introduced personal taxation. In England, this was known as the Poll Tax. Over the centuries, surnames have continued to "evolve" in all countries, often leading to remarkable variations in the original spelling.
